The housing market in Manhattan, NY is much more expensive than the average US city. The median value of houses in Manhattan is over $1 million while the median value in the US is only $338,100. Despite this large gap, both areas have seen similar appreciation rates of 8.22% and 8.27%, respectively, within the last year. This indicates that while Manhattan may be pricey, it is still a strong investment for potential buyers.

The median home cost in Manhattan is $1,169,400.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 62.6%. Home Appreciation in Manhattan is up 10.8%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Manhattan real estate is 67 years old
The Rental Market in Manhattan
- Renters make up 67.2% of the Manhattan population
- 3.7% of houses and apartments in Manhattan, are available to rent
